Often known as a ‘chemist’, a community pharmacy provides medication, healthcare advice, and retail products to customers. It’s a key component of the pharmacy industry which also comprises hospital pharmacy and industrial pharmacy.
What is the outlook for the community pharmacy sector?
With an aging population and an increase in chronic diseases, community pharmacies provide an essential service for almost every town and city in Australia. As the first port of call for health concerns, there are 443.6 million individual patient visits to pharmacies each year, making it a key part of the healthcare sector.What roles are available in community pharmacies?
There are a number of roles in community pharmacies, including:- Pharmacists - Who dispense medications, advise customers, and ensure patient safety.
- Pharmacy Technicians - Who assists pharmacists with dispensing and customer service.
- Pharmacy Assistants - Who helps with customer service, sales, and some dispensing tasks.
What is the role of a pharmacy assistant?
Pharmacy assistants work in customer service, process sales, and may assist with dispensing medications under pharmacist supervision.What qualifications are required for pharmacy assistants?
Under the Quality Care Pharmacy Program (QCPP) a minimum S2/S3 certification is required to handle over-the-counter and pharmacist-only medications.What is the role of a pharmacy technician?
Pharmacy Technicians help pharmacists prepare and dispense medicines. In a community pharmacy, technicians are also often involved in customer service duties and provide medical advice to customers under the supervision of the pharmacist on duty.How do I become a pharmacy technician?
To meet the requirements of the Pharmacy Board of Australia, a Cert IV in Community Pharmacy Dispensary or SIRSS00012 Community Pharmacy Dispensary qualification is recommended.Why should I consider a career in pharmacy?

How can I enter the pharmacy industry?
An S2/S3 certification is a great way to get your foot in the door of the pharmacy industry. Completed online in as little as two days, this qualification does not require you to currently work in a community pharmacy and equips you to supply pharmacy medications and assist the pharmacist in the dispensary with the supply of pharmacist only medications.What career pathways are available in the pharmacy industry?
You can progress from a pharmacy assistant to a senior role, become a pharmacy manager, or pursue further education to become a pharmacist. Other opportunities include hospital and industrial pharmacy roles.Are there job opportunities in community pharmacies?
Yes, community pharmacies exist in cities, towns, and rural areas, ensuring employment opportunities nationwide.There are currently 39,900 pharmacy assistants and 6900 pharmacy technician positions in Australia, and the sector is growing.That said, it is a sought after part of the retail sector, with qualifications such as the S2/S3 allowing you to stand out from the crowd.What skills are important for working in a pharmacy?
